Shafaq News/ A Palestinian worker fromJenin drove a stolen vehicle into a military base in Tel Aviv on Tuesday,injuring an Israeli soldier, Israeli media reported.
The news site Walla said the suspect, whowas working illegally in Tel Aviv, took a car and drove it through a checkpointat the entrance of the Tzrifin military base, striking a soldier before beingarrested in Ramle.
Walla quoted an Israeli army spokespersonas saying that the injured soldier sustained moderate injuries and wastransferred to a hospital for treatment.
